About the Position
Strategic leadership, supervision, program oversight, and stakeholder engagement to accelerate progress toward reducing new HIV infections and improving health outcomes for people with HIV (PWH). Ensuring that interventions align with the four key EHE pillars—Diagnose/Treat/Prevent/ Respond—while addressing health disparities among PWH. Responsibility for the implementation of EHE-focused initiatives, ensuring alignment with national, state, and local HIV prevention and care strategies. Develop and implement high-impact, data-driven interventions to reduce new HIV infections, improve linkage to care and re-engagement in care Oversee strategies to increase retention in HIV care and adherence to antiretroviral therapy (ART) to achieve viral suppression (U=U).Promote rapid ART initiation for newly diagnosed individuals and those re-engaging in care. Manage EHE-funded grants, ensuring compliance with federal HRSA, state, and local requirements. Develop funding proposals and oversee budgeting, reporting, and resource allocation. Monitor performance metrics and program impact to guide continuous improvements in overall goals and objectives of the EHE initiative. And other duties as assigned.
